  • Patent number: 10207455
    Abstract: The present techniques are directed to a flexible pipe. An inner carcass layer forms the innermost layer of the flexible pipe. An inner sheath layer and an outer sheath layer are disposed externally of the inner carcass layer. A layer of corrosion resistant alloy is disposed at any location between the inner carcass layer and the outer sheath layer. At least one armor layer is disposed internally of the outer sheath layer.

  • Patent number: 7897267
    Abstract: A tubular assembly comprising a first iron based tubular having a first non-cladded inner surface; and a second iron based tubular having a second non-cladded inner surface, wherein the first tubular is connected to the second tubular using a non-iron based bonding material. Preferably, the non-iron based bonding material has a lower crack growth rate than the iron based tubulars.
